About this center

Poplar Springs Hospital is an addiction treatment provider in Petersburg, Virginia. According to the public treatment facility listing record for this address, the program offers both residential and outpatient services, covering medical detox, inpatient hospital, residential treatment, and intensive outpatient (iop), among 6 listed levels of care.

The same record identifies treatment for substance use disorder, alcohol use disorder, opioid use disorder, benzodiazepine use disorder, and cocaine use disorder. Programming is listed as serving active duty military, adolescents, adults, co-occurring disorders / dual diagnosis, and hiv/aids support. Services are listed as available in English.

Listed accreditation and treatment approaches include Brief Intervention, Buprenorphine,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T), Motivational Interviewing, and Naltrexone.
